This is the end of the Great Wall after it travels over 5,000 kms through 7 provinces in China.
This part is well maintained and has a beautiful Temple at one point on the mountain, which links to the final climb which ends the wall.
We went by car and the turnoff to Nazhighen Pass is an hour from yangquan and 360 kms from Beijing.
The road is the main road from Beijing and is full of heavy vehicles and heavily loaded trucks so can be a long drive.
The turnoff road is used by trucks and is badly damaged in places. The Great Wall is a wonderful experience
